Output 8bef142ae1b74e138d8532c122e4b692e400e2bc1b3642bc2d97f06b8e32c115:0

value
3098104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de7d3e2cb1caeccd8a5e176fa4674d01c9c777f OP_EQUAL
address
32xYRhxver2Gq9yjE8ycew9vbZng7fWMUQ
transaction
8bef142ae1b74e138d8532c122e4b692e400e2bc1b3642bc2d97f06b8e32c115
confirmations
423520
spent
true